Host Platform Liability: Boston vs Chelsea

How do host platform liability rules compare between Boston, MA and Chelsea, MA?

Boston, MA

Suffolk County

Heavy Restrictions

Booking platforms operating in Boston must verify host registration numbers before processing bookings. Platforms processing payments for unregistered units face direct city fines, separate from host-side penalties under Boston's STR ordinance.

Boston FAQ

Do platforms have to share host data with the City?

Yes. Quarterly reports include host name, address, registration number, total nights booked, and revenue, used by ISD for enforcement and tax verification.

Is this preempted by federal law?

No. The First Circuit held in Airbnb v. Boston that registration-verification rules regulate the platform's own conduct, not user content, so Section 230 does not preempt them.
